Skip to content

Commit c2a3a2c

Browse files
authored
[Tracing] Default tracer to global bootstrapped tracer (#861)
1 parent 8430dd4 commit c2a3a2c

File tree

1 file changed

+5
-1
lines changed

1 file changed

+5
-1
lines changed

Sources/AsyncHTTPClient/HTTPClient.swift

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1095,7 +1095,11 @@ public final class HTTPClient: Sendable {
10951095
package var attributeKeys: AttributeKeys
10961096

10971097
public init() {
1098-
self._tracer = nil
1098+
if #available(macOS 10.15, iOS 13, tvOS 13, watchOS 6, *) {
1099+
self._tracer = InstrumentationSystem.tracer
1100+
} else {
1101+
self._tracer = nil
1102+
}
10991103
self.attributeKeys = .init()
11001104
}
11011105

0 commit comments

Comments
 (0)